I prayed for you. I too am struggling with depression. Something that has been helpful to me is writing a list of things that I think i am. Then I wrote down all the things God says I am. The differances are really startling. I was shocked at how much I was hating and hurting myself. I was constantly bashing myself. God commands us to love our neighbor as we love ourselfs.

In Galatians 5:13-15 Paul says, "13 For you have been called to live in freedom, my brothers and sisters. But don’t use your freedom to satisfy your sinful nature. Instead, use your freedom to serve one another in love. 14 For the whole law can be summed up in this one command: “Love your neighbor as yourself.” 15 But if you are always biting and devouring one another, watch out! Beware of destroying one another."

How can you love your neighbor as yourself when you bash yourself constantly? Then i thought well, what is Love? 1st Corinthians 13:4-7 says, "
4 Love is patient and kind. Love is not jealous or boastful or proud 5 or rude. It does not demand its own way. It is not irritable, and it keeps no record of being wronged. 6 It does not rejoice about injustice but rejoices whenever the truth wins out. 7 Love never gives up, never loses faith, is always hopeful, and endures through every circumstance." Are you patient with yourself? Are you kind to yourself? Take out Love in these verses and exchange them with your name. Example, "Alex is patient and kind. Alex is not jealous or boastful or proud or rude. Alex does not demand her own way. Alex is not irritable, and keeps no record of being wronged. Alex does not rejoice about injustice but rejoices whenever the truth wins out. Alex never gives up, never loses faith, is always hopeful, and endures through every cicumstance."

I know that with all the bashing and self-hating I've been dishing myself for years that I can't honestly say that. But I can take this verse and repeat it to myself through out the day. A declaration and decision of what I am and what I will do. I still mess up, but I find that my relationships, my attitude, my inner thoughts, have all been brighter and happier because of it.

God has forgiven you. He loves you so much that he came and died for you. He was so desprete to be with you that he died the most horible death imaginable. God doesn't need us, he wants us. If God has forgiven us than we should in turn forgive ourselfs. I'm praying for you.

God knows that your a sinner and still loves you. You can be a Christian and still mess up. I know I do. No one but Jesus is perfect, Just like in 1 Corinthians you need to be patient with yourself. God is love and that verse is an absolute promise to us. he will never leave or forsake us. You should also go to a doctor to help. I know that might seem like a bad idea or like your saying your crazy. but I promise its not. depression is sometimes a chemical reaction or lack of. Some people only need to help stablize their body through taking daily vitamins and following a routine and getting at least 8 hours of sleep. But sometimes (including myself) people need help with it. A doctor can help. Also talk to your friends and family about how you feel. If you don't feel comforatable with that than talk to a counselor. I prayed that this doesn't offend you. I merely want to be helpful. Please do seek help from a friend, a family member, and/or professional help. May God bless you.
